What is the empirical formula for glucose?

The empirical formula for glucose is ##”CH”_2″O”##.

An empirical formula represents the lowest whole number ratio of in a compound.

The molecular formula for glucose is ##”C”_6″H”_12″O”_6″##. The subscripts represent a multiple of an empirical formula. To determine the empirical formula, divide the subscripts by the GCF of ##6##, which gives ##”CH”_2″O”##.

The empirical formula ##”CH”_2″O”## shows very clearly that glucose, a carbohydrate, is composed of hydrated carbon atoms.
